    Which Businesses in Tanzania Should Prioritize ISO Certification Today?

    Every business stands to benefit, but some sectors in Tanzania are particularly experiencing a high surge in demand for ISO certification due to being a national focus and as a requirement for international markets.

    Finance institutions, agro processors, tourist operators, manufacturers, and even mining companies are some of the key Tanzanian businesses that are fueled by exports, assuring quality, and compliance adopting internationally recognized standards enhancing competitiveness.

    Let’s examine some of the most prominent Industries in Tanzania and the types of their businesses that would strongly benefit from having ISO Certification:

    Agriculture & Agro-Processing (Arusha, Mbeya, Morogoro):

      • Businesses to target: large scale farms, food processing plants(capital based), coffee and tea farms, spacer exporters and seafood processors.

      • Relevant ISO Standards: ISO 14001 Environmental Management for Sustainable form, ISO 9001 Quality management for uniform product output, and ISO 22000 Food Safety Management for pre-requisite export value.

      • Why now: EU, US and Asia stringently control global imports; fair trade certifications and access for high value imports.
    Tourism & Hospitality (Zanzibar, Arusha, Dar es Salaam):

        • Target Businesses: Hotels, lodges, safari operators, tour agencies, restaurants and marine conservation firms.

        • Relevant ISO Standards: ISO 9001 for service excellence; ISO 14001 for eco tourism; ISO 45001 for guest and staff safety.

        • Why now: Increases competitive advantage due to the booming travel sector, broadens marketing scope, improves reputation, and enhances the attractiveness for eco conscious tourists.

    Mining & Extractive Industries (Geita, Shinyanga, Mtwara):
      • Target Businesses: Gold mining companies, tanzanite mining companies, gas exploration companies, and mineral processing plants.

      • Relevant ISO Standards: ISO 14001 for resource extraction; ISO 45001 for occupational health and safety in hazardous workplaces; ISO 9001 for quality management and standardized procedures.

      • Why now: Fortifies the claim on responsible resource management while ensuring worker welfare which is essential to uphold reputation and meet expectations from international investors.

    Manufacturing (Dar es Salaam, Morogoro, Mwanza):

      • Target Businesses: Textile factories and cement producers, beverage manufacturers, plastics and pharmaceutical companies.

      • Relevant ISO Standards: ISO 9001(quality management) ensures product quality; ISO 14001 makes sure production is environmentally friendly; ISO 45001 guarantees safe working conditions at the factory.

      • Why now: To enhance the quality of products for both local and overseas markets, reduce operational costs by creating efficiency, and comply with national industrialization targets.

    Financial & ICT Services (Dar es Salaam, Arusha):

      • Target Businesses: Commercial banks, microfinance institutions, mobile money services, software development companies, data storage centers.

      • Relevant ISO Standards: Information protection ISO 27001, quality management ISO 9001 for service delivery.

      • Why now: To protect highly sensitive client information, foster confidence in online transactions, and comply with stringent privacy laws.

    What is the Process of Getting ISO Certified in Tanzania with Maxicert?

    Here at Maxicert, we assist you through every step as you work to gain an ISO certification in Tanzania.

    In Tanzania, businesses need to follow Maxicert’s steps of Gap Analysis, Documentation, Staff Training, Internal Audit, Audit Certification facilitation, Post-Certification Support to achieve set global standards.

    Here’s how we seamlessly guide you through the process:

    • Gap Analysis: We employ highly skilled consultants who analyze your available systems against the ISO standard you intend to use and undertake a gap analysis. This analysis examines gaps and strengths that are relevant to your site in Tanzania.

    • System Documentation: We assist in creating or updating all objectives’ manuals, procedures, and policies, which is necessary as per the ISO standard, ensuring their use in practice with daily operations.

    • Training & Awareness: It is our responsibility to train and make each of your staff members comprehend the ISO standards and adequately ensure that they know their positions alongside how to partake in the management system.

    • Internal Audit: Maxicert does internal audits to check if the system that was put in place and operated is working and if there are gaps, correcting them in readiness for external audits.

    • Certification Audit Facilitation: We walk you through the audit process with a third-party certification body, ensuring all outcomes meet required standards and expectations.

    • Post-Certification Support: Our support does not stop with certification. We aid with surveillance audits, re-certifications, system enhancements, and support, ensuring your systems sustain their strength.
